About this audiobook

Before her beautiful bouncing babies came along, Ellie Haskell's life was a fairy tale. Marriage to the gorgeous super-chef Ben was going swimmingly before every day was filled with nappies, bottles and laundry. Determined to revive her love life, Ellie joins a new local ladies' group, Fully Female, which promises to restore some oomph back to her relationship by way of a Peach Melba Love Rub. But before long, things start going fatally wrong in the charming village of Chitterton Fells. First, one of Ellie's new friends from the group is electrocuted in her own bathtub. Then Ellie gets a call from another group member. Her husband has fallen to his death in their boudoir at a rather inopportune moment . . . One death could be an accident, but two is decidedly suspicious. Can Ellie save her marriage without falling foul of the curse of these femmes fatal?

About the author

Dorothy Cannell was born in London, England, and now lives in Belfast, Maine. Dorothy Cannell writes mysteries featuring Ellie Haskell, interior decorator and Ben Haskell, writer and chef, and Hyacinth and Primrose Tramwell, a pair of dotty sisters and owners of the Flowers Detection Agency.

Sasha Higgins, a classically trained actress and voice artist, has performed on the West End, at the Geffen, and off- Broadway. She has also starred in numerous independent films and voiced the role of Miranda in The Tempest for BBC Radio 4. She currently lives in Venice, California, with her husband, Ethan, and two dogs.
